	Problem 1: .tar.gz-distributed applications do not register
themselves in any applications database.  Hence, they have problems that
make them difficult to install and administer: they cannot verify
dependencies, cannot confirm the "correct" directory structure expected by
Gnome, cannot run post-install scripts or post un-install scripts, and
cannot check to see if a previous (or more up-to-date) version of the app
is installed.

	Problem 2: Existing package systems are not system-independent.
Not everyone has RPM, DEB, or SLP installed.  (However, it should be noted
that converters are available for these systems--i.e., alien)

	Problem 3: Even RPMs and DEBs require root access to the
applications database to install new packages.

	Some points to consider in the upcoming discussion: SLPs (am I
getting that acronym right?) are just .tar.gz files with extra data files
in them.  That means they can just be ungzipped for non-SLP systems.
